Transaction 666147d96dc5359fb03eeab054850d93307199090cb16e10c109f9dc9a8293d7

1 Input
2 Outputs
  • 666147d96dc5359fb03eeab054850d93307199090cb16e10c109f9dc9a8293d7:0
  • value  16000000
    address  31qe3ZGww23AmzydCuWmykM3DF6mWUVAu1
  • 666147d96dc5359fb03eeab054850d93307199090cb16e10c109f9dc9a8293d7:1
  • value  156886310
    address  18FckwYtKa4kVkwWSZ4yf93MaDH3b6MpT2